R V ANTHONY CHARLES RALPH (2000)

PUBLISHED November 29, 2000
SHARE

A direction as to circumstances where manslaughter could be found in a murder trial, given well after the jury retired and just as they were about to present their verdict, did not render a conviction for murder unsafe.

CA (Crim Div) (Henry LJ, Hooper J, Goldring J)
